I know the consensus has been to use a whitening toothpaste, but I was wondering if anyone has come up with something that might work better. Or maybe I'm not using the toothpaste correctly. I put it on a dampened soft cloth, rub lightly and then use a dampened clth to wipe it off with. I also tried a clay bar (no bueno).

My experience has been any type of abrasive cleaner, i.e. polishing compund, turns it darker. It seems motor has orange peel surface to it and raised portion gets cut with abrasive cleaner and turns dark.
